Claritycon2025 was a huge, resounding success! The annual children’s mental health conference provided professional development to 650+ mental health professionals on July 16 and 17, 2025 at San Antonio’s Henry B. Gonzalez Convention Center.

In keeping with our mission to support children and families in their pursuit of mental wellness, Clarity Child Guidance Center has hosted Claritycon for the past 12 years. Tickets entitle attendees with up to 11 hours of professional development (including CEU and CNE certificates) from presentations by 39 renowned experts; four meals plus snacks, including breakfast and lunch keynote addresses; and Thursday wrap-up luncheon with keynote speaker Andrew Bridge, author of NY Times Bestseller Hope’s Boy: A Memoir and USA Today bestseller The Child Catcher: A Fight for Justice and Truth.

Some of Claritycon2025’s accomplishments include:
  • Over 670 attendees, which is is up from 511 attendees in 2024
  • Inside Texas, attendees travelled from as far away as Lubbock and the Rio Grande Valley
  • Outside Texas, attendees came from Oklahoma, North Carolina, Florida, New Mexico, Alabama, Minnesota and Wisconsin
  • In online evaluations:
    • 96 percent of attendees rated the conference as either “good” or “very good”
    • 100 percent of attendees rated the communication from Clarity prior to the event as either “satisfactory” or “very satisfactory”
    • 72 percent of attendees rated the communication from Clarity prior to the event as “very satisfactory”
  • Attendee’s professions included CEOs, owners of agencies, social workers, nurses, teachers, principals, clinical mental health mental health therapists, case workers and school counselors
  • Half of all attendees took advantage of our “early bird” ticket discount

Topics for Claritycon2025 included, but were not limited to:
  • Adolescent brain development
  • Trauma informed care (TIC)
  • Grief and discussing death
  • Cultural competency (BIPOC, LGBTQIA+, etc.)
  • Ethics for healthcare professionals
  • Human trafficking
  • Juvenile justice
  • Music therapy
  • Play therapy / Recreational therapy and how to incorporate in daily life
  • Mental health diagnoses, medications, coping strategies, and support (autism spectrum disorder, depression, anxiety, ADHD, etc.)
  • Self-esteem
  • Foster care
